ICE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

881 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Intercontinental Exchange (ICE)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$38.7B — up 2.2% from $37.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 94 funds opened new ICE posit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 347 added to existing stakes and 329 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Lazard Asset Management, adding an estimated $348M. The largest seller was Jackson Square Partners, exiting entirely with an estimated $533M sold.
